Skip to content

CWG2669 Lifetime extension for aggregate initialization #1511

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open
jensmaurer opened this issue May 12, 2023 · 2 comments
Open

CWG2669 Lifetime extension for aggregate initialization #1511

jensmaurer opened this issue May 12, 2023 · 2 comments
Labels
EWG Evolution paper needed An issue needs a paper to describe its solution

Comments

@jensmaurer
Copy link
Member

Parenthesized aggregate initialization has the potential to cause a diagnosable dangling reference.

EWG is asked to review CWG2669.

@jensmaurer jensmaurer added the EWG Evolution label May 12, 2023
@erichkeane
Copy link
Collaborator

EWG Discussed this on Monday in Varna, and the room expressed a more coherent presentation of the problem, so an author was identified to come back with a paper later this week.

@erichkeane erichkeane added the paper needed An issue needs a paper to describe its solution label Mar 18, 2024
@hanickadot
Copy link
Collaborator

hanickadot commented Jun 24, 2024

EWG St. Louis: The author was re-identified as Michal Dominiak

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
EWG Evolution paper needed An issue needs a paper to describe its solution
Projects
None yet
Development

No branches or pull requests

4 participants